Björn Pettersson
59286193fc
[lit] Add support to print paths relative to CWD in the test summary report (#154317)
This patch adds a -r|--relative-paths option to llvm-lit, which when
enabled will print test case names using paths relative to the current
working directory. The legacy default without that option is that test
cases are identified using a path relative to the test suite.

Only the summary report is impacted. That normally include failed tests,
unless unless options such as --show-pass.

Background to this patch was the discussion here

https://discourse.llvm.org/t/test-case-paths-in-llvm-lit-output-are-lacking-the-location-of-the-test-dir-itself/87973
with a goal to making it easier to copy-n-paste the path to the failing
test cases.

Examples showing difference in "Passed Tests" and "Failed Tests":

 > llvm-lit --show-pass test/Transforms/Foo
 PASS: LLVM :: Transforms/Foo/test1.txt (1 of 2)
 FAIL: LLVM :: Transforms/Foo/test2.txt (2 of 2)
 Passed Tests (1):
   LLVM :: Transforms/Foo/test1.txt
 Failed Tests (1):
   LLVM :: Transforms/Foo/test2.txt

 > llvm-lit --show-pass --relative-paths test/Transforms/Foo
 PASS: LLVM :: Transforms/Foo/test1.txt (1 of 2)
 FAIL: LLVM :: Transforms/Foo/test2.txt (2 of 2)
 Passed Tests (1):
   test/Transforms/Foo/test1.txt
 Failed Tests (1):
   test/Transforms/Foo/test2.txt

Peter Smith
bcf09c1bc7
[ARM][Disassembler] Advance IT State when instruction is unknown (#154531)
When an instruction that the disassembler does not recognize is in an IT
block, we should still advance the IT state otherwise the IT state
spills over into the next recognized instruction, which is incorrect.

We want to avoid disassembly like:
it eq
<unknown> // Often because disassembler has insufficient target info. 
addeq r0,r0,r0 // eq spills over into add.

Fixes #150569

Benjamin Maxwell
bfab8085af
[libunwind] Add support for the AArch64 "Vector Granule" (VG) register (#153565)
The vector granule (AArch64 DWARF register 46) is a pseudo-register that
contains the available size in bits of SVE vector registers in the
current call frame, divided by 64. The vector granule can be used in
DWARF expressions to describe SVE/SME stack frame layouts (e.g., the
location of SVE callee-saves).

The first time VG is evaluated (if not already set), it is initialized
to the result of evaluating a "CNTD" instruction (this assumes SVE is
available).

To support SME, the value of VG can change per call frame; this is
currently handled like any other callee-save and is intended to support
the unwind information implemented in #152283. This limits how VG is
used in the CFI information of functions with "streaming-mode changes"
(mode changes that change the SVE vector length), to make the unwinder's
job easier.

Pengcheng Wang
17a98f85c2
[RISCV] Optimize the spill/reload of segment registers (#153184)
The simplest way is:

1. Save `vtype` to a scalar register.
2. Insert a `vsetvli`.
3. Use segment load/store.
4. Restore `vtype` via `vsetvl`.

But `vsetvl` is usually slow, so this PR is not in this way.

Instead, we use wider whole load/store instructions if the register
encoding is aligned. We have done the same optimization for COPY in
https://github.com/llvm/llvm-project/pull/84455.

We found this suboptimal implementation when porting some video codec
kernels via RVV intrinsics.

Yi Kong
1ff7c8bf0d [compiler-rt] Fix musl build
The change in PR #154268 introduced a dependency on the `__GLIBC_PREREQ`
macro, which is not defined in musl libc. This caused the build to fail
in environments using musl.

This patch fixes the build by including
`sanitizer_common/sanitizer_glibc_version.h`. This header provides a
fallback definition for `__GLIBC_PREREQ` when LLVM is built against
non-glibc C libraries, resolving the compilation error.
